Is microwaving broccoli as healthy as steaming?
Pellegrini et al. (2010) reported that boiling and steaming caused a significant loss of total antioxidant capacity of frozen broccoli, while microwaving without additional water did not. What is the best cooking method for broccoli?
High Heat–Roast (425°F)- Heat the oven to 425°F.
- Toss the broccoli florets, stem coins, and a few tablespoons of extra-virgin olive oil on a rimmed sheet pan. Season with salt.
- Roast, stirring occasionally, until tender, 20 to 25 minutes.
How to perfectly steam broccoli without a steamer?
Stove Top:- Place 1-2″ of water in the bottom of a pot with a lid and heat over high heat until boiling. Add broccoli and place lid on top.
- Cook for 3-4 minutes. Carefully and quickly place broccoli in a colander (strainer) and run cold water over broccoli.
- Serve warm, tossed with optional garnishes if required.
How many minutes to steam in the microwave?
Microwave on high! Firmer vegetables like turnips or potatoes may take 6-8 minutes, and softer, moister veg like broccoli will take less – around 4 minutes. Leafy greens like spinach may only take 3!
